SUMMARY
Industrial wastewater is
different from municipal wastewater, while the limits for treated effluent
discharge and the target for re-use are typically the same and derived from the
BAT for municipal wastewater treatment. Also main treatment unitary processes
are the same; however a proper adaptation to the specificity of the different
industrial wastewater streams is needed.
The paper aims to provide some real life
examples of challenges due to the specificity of wastewater source (high TDS,
high temperature, some specific streams like the spent caustic), to the lack of
previous similar experiences (like the use of membrane bioreactor for
refineries and/or the use of absorption chillers and plate and frame heat
exchanger) or to specific legislation aiming to protect sensitive environment
(limits on total nitrogen or on soluble metals) were faced and overcome
achieving treatment and/or re-use standards. Moreover the items related to the
overall optimization of the water cycle around the industrial facilities with
appropriate utilization of existing wastewater treatment units for the most
appropriate purpose as well as the selection between municipal and industrial
treated effluents as a source for water re-use are also discussed.
